Anyone use Netflix?
Anyone use Netflix?
I was thinking about giving it a try, but I'm a little leery about it, especially the "make a list and get them when they're available" aspect of it. Also, how long does it take for them go deliver/receive DVDs? They say "next business day" but make no mention of how long it takes for them to get it back so you can rent another movie.

Netflix is awesome.  No more going to the video store or late fees.  Sometimes, I get the movie the next day.  For example, I put it at the top of my que at 7a.m., it ships that day after noon, and I get it the next day.  Mostly, it takes a couple of days, though.  You have to gauge your returns to time them well if you're looking to get a popular new release.  When a release date is noted with the movie, it means the day before actually (it's a time zone thing or something).  I'm a total convert to Netflix.  Screw Blockbuster and Hollywood video!  The reason Netflix works is because they get the movies to you on time and lost returns are no hassle at all.  Your concerns (natural, common sense doubts) were addressed in the creation of that company, I believe. They ship from the nearest distribution center and the returns go to the nearest site also, so everything is very fast.
			
			
									
						
										
						They have a pretty decent selection, better then block busters. If your seriously into a jonra you'll probable notice that their collection isn't complete. While it is true that it takes a day to send the dvds, it usually takes a day to process, and public mail doesn't work on the weekends. So it's basically ones a week. or 5 days round trip. 
If your on one dvd at a time that's works out to be 2.5 a rental. If your at two at a time with a limit of four per month that's 1.5 a rental, 2 a month with out the limit is 1.875 a movie. 3 at a time 1.5 per move. Assuming you watch the movie right away, and get it back out the next day. Other wise your basically giving up another rental, and then your paying double.
I like netflix, but I hear there are other services that offer wider verity of rentals. (adult dvd, video games, old movies, complete collections)
